Understanding the Rodent Threat in South Florida

Coral Springs' warm climate and abundant green spaces are ideal for humans and rodents alike. Common invaders include roof rats, Norway rats, and house mice. These animals are prolific breeders and relentless in their search for food, water, and shelter, often finding it in our attics, wall voids, and garages. The problems they cause are multifaceted: they contaminate food and surfaces with droppings and urine, gnaw on electrical wiring (a major fire hazard), and damage insulation and structural wood 1 2. A proactive approach to rodent removal is essential for maintaining a safe and healthy living environment.

The Professional Rodent Extermination Process

Local pest control companies follow a systematic, multi-phase approach to ensure rodents are eliminated and prevented from returning. This methodology is far more comprehensive than a one-time treatment.

1. Thorough Inspection and Assessment

The process almost always begins with a detailed inspection, which is typically offered for free by most providers 3 4. A trained technician will examine your property's interior and exterior, looking for telltale signs like droppings, gnaw marks, grease smudges (from rodent fur), and nesting materials. They will meticulously identify potential entry points, which can be as small as a dime for mice, around roof vents, utility line penetrations, foundation cracks, and gaps under doors 3 1. This inspection is crucial for developing a targeted action plan.

2. Elimination and Treatment Phase

Once the scope of the infestation is understood, the technician will implement a customized elimination strategy. This usually involves a combination of methods:

  • Professional Trapping: Strategically placing a series of traps in active areas like attics, crawl spaces, and along walls to capture existing rodents 3 2.
  • Tamper-Resistant Bait Stations: Placing secure, locked bait boxes in strategic outdoor locations. These stations lure rodents and contain the problem safely, preventing access by children, pets, or non-target wildlife 3 1 5.

3. Critical Exclusion Work (Sealing Entry Points)

Trapping and baiting address the current population, but exclusion is the key to long-term prevention. This critical step involves sealing every identified entry hole and gap with durable materials like concrete, steel wool, hardware cloth, or heavy-duty caulk 3 2 5. Without proper exclusion, new rodents will simply find their way back in, making any treatment a temporary fix. Many companies consider this the most important part of a lasting rodent control solution.

4. Follow-Up, Monitoring, and Prevention

A reputable service doesn't end with the initial cleanup. Ongoing monitoring is part of many service plans. This includes regular follow-up visits (often quarterly) to check traps and bait stations, re-inspect for new activity, and ensure exclusion seals are holding 6. Technicians also provide valuable sanitation and habitat modification advice, such as recommendations for trimming tree branches away from the roof, securing trash cans, and eliminating standing water to make your property less attractive to pests 1 2.

What to Expect from Local Rodent Control Services

When evaluating rodent management companies in Coral Springs, you'll find they offer various service models to fit different needs and budgets. Understanding these options helps you make an informed choice.

Service Plans and Pricing Structures

Costs can vary based on the property size, infestation severity, and the extent of exclusion work needed. Based on local service models, here is a general framework:

  • Initial Comprehensive Service: This one-time service for an active infestation typically ranges from $200 to $500 or more. It generally includes the inspection, the elimination work (trapping/baiting), and often some basic exclusion sealing 3 7 8.
  • Exclusion-Only or Major Repairs: If significant sealing work is required-such as repairing vent screens or closing large foundation gaps-this can be an additional project. Focused exclusion work can add $150 to $300+ to the total cost, depending on the labor and materials involved 3 9.
  • Ongoing Maintenance Plans: For continued protection and monitoring, many homeowners opt for quarterly visits. These recurring services typically cost between $50 and $150+ per visit and focus on prevention, monitoring, and addressing any new concerns 7 6 8.

Choosing the Right Provider

Look for licensed and insured professionals with specific experience in rodent work. They should be willing to explain their process in detail, emphasize the importance of exclusion, and offer a clear plan for both immediate elimination and long-term prevention. Ask about their follow-up protocol and what their service guarantees or warranties cover.

Long-Term Rodent Prevention for Coral Springs Homes

Partnering with a professional is the most effective step, but homeowners can take supportive actions:

  • Seal Your Home: Conduct your own periodic audit. Use weather stripping on doors, install chimney caps, and seal cracks around pipes with appropriate materials.
  • Manage Landscaping: Keep tree limbs and shrubs trimmed back at least several feet from your roofline and exterior walls to remove rodent highways 1.
  • Eliminate Food Sources: Store pet food, bird seed, and human food in airtight containers. Use trash cans with tight-fitting lids and manage compost piles carefully.
  • Reduce Clutter: Clear out storage areas in garages, sheds, and attics where rodents can hide and nest.

Taking a proactive, integrated approach combining professional expertise with smart home maintenance is the best defense against rodent infestations in our community.
